Fits 200 kW across eight MPPT channels.
Eight independent MPP trackers process up to 200 kW of rooftop solar. Sixteen strings connect directly with 42 A rating per tracker. Two battery circuits handle large high-voltage storage banks. The 97 kg IP66 enclosure runs in ambient temperatures from minus 35 to 60 C.
Runs 110 kVA on the AC grid port
Nominal AC output is 100 kW with 110 kVA maximum apparent power to or from the grid. Adjustable power factor ranges from 0.8 leading to 0.8 lagging.
Fits 200 kW on sixteen strings
Eight MPPT channels handle 42 A each with 2 strings per tracker. MPPT voltage ranges from 160 to 950 V with 99.9 percent tracker efficiency.
Holds two 300 to 800 V battery inputs
Two dedicated battery inputs operate on a 600 V nominal bus. High-voltage lithium storage charges and discharges at up to 98.2 percent efficiency.

What is the maximum grid apparent power of the GW100K-ET-G10?
110 kVA maximum apparent power to or from the grid.
- Nominal AC power: 100 kW on three phases.
- Sibling comparison: GW99.99K-ET-G10 is capped at 99.99 kVA for grid-limit rules.
- Peak efficiency: 98.1 percent.
How many solar strings connect to the GW100K-ET-G10?
Sixteen strings distributed across eight MPP trackers.
- Array rating: 200 kW maximum PV input.
- Tracker currents: 42 A per MPPT.
- Voltage range: 160 to 950 V MPPT window.
What battery configuration does the GW100K-ET-G10 support?
Two high-voltage battery inputs from 300 to 800 V DC.
- Nominal battery voltage: 600 V.
- BMS link: CAN communication protocol.
What are the chassis weight and enclosure ratings of the GW100K-ET-G10?
97 kg wall-mounted cabinet with IP66 ingress protection.
- Dimensions: 995 x 758 x 358 mm.
- Cooling: smart fan cooling from minus 35 to plus 60 C.
